Throughout the multiverse the name Optimus Prime is associated with bravery, self-sacrifice and an indomitable fighting spirit, a warrior always ready to lay down their own life to protect sentient life, no matter its form.
| “ | You just wanna die for the guy! That's leadership... or brainwashin' or somethin'. | ” |
| “ | No... that's Optimus Prime. | ” |
—Crosshairs and Drift on their leader, Transformers: Age of Extinction | ||

Full list of Optimus Primes
- 1984 — Optimus Prime the Autobot Supreme Commander and Cybertronic/Earth truck in the Generation 1 continuity family.

- 1985 — The Optimus Prime clone, an astoundingly stupid idea of Megatron's from the episode "A Prime Problem".
- 2000 — Optimus Prime the Autobot Supreme Commander and Earth fire truck from Robots in Disguise.
- 2002 — Optimus Prime the Autobot Supreme Commander and Earth truck in the Unicron Trilogy.

- 2004 — Optimus Prime the Autobot whose corpse was cloned and tortured by Unicron to create Nemesis Prime; this was also in Universe.
- 2007 — Optimus Prime, leader of the Autobots, Earth truck and last of the Dynasty of Primes from the live-action film series.

- 2007 — Optimus Prime the young and inexperienced leader of an Autobot squadron and Cybertronic/Earth truck from Animated.

- 2008 — Optimus Prime the despotic leader of the evil Autobots in Shattered Glass.
- 2008 — Optimus Prime the leader of the Transcendent Technomorphs in TransTech.
- 2010 — Optimus Prime the leader of the Autobots, Cybertronic/Earth truck and member of the thirteen original Transformers in the Aligned continuity family.

- 2011 — Optimus Prime the evil Autobot renegade from Shattered Glass Animated.
- 2011 — Optimus Prime the Autobot brick-based being and Kreon from Kre-O.
- 2011 — Darkside Optimus Prime the living embodiment of the darkness in the live-action film series Optimus Prime's mind who wants to destroy all Optimus Primes across time and space.
- 2011 — Darkside Optimus Prime the living embodiment of the darkness in Generation 1 Optimus Prime's mind.
- 2012 — Optimus Prime Blaster the Autobot Arms Micron who takes the shape of Optimus from Prime.
- 2014 — Optimus Prime the Autobot lead singer from Knights of Unicron.
- 2014 — Optimus Prime Bird the Angry Bird transformed into an Optimus Prime facsimile in Angry Birds Transformers.
- 2014 — Optimus Prime the Autobot from Battle Masters.
- 2017 — Optimus Prime the evil Autobot from the Shattered Glass Unicron Trilogy.
- 2017 — Domitius Major the Eukarian explorer from the IDW Generation 1 continuity who took up the mantle of "Optimus Prime" following the loss of his own memories.
